3.6.4.6 Icons
.............

If you frequently switch between DDD and other multi-window
applications, you may like to set `Edit => Preferences => General =>
Iconify all windows at once'.  This way, all DDD windows are iconified
and deiconified as a group.

   This is tied to the following resource:

 -- Resource: groupIconify (class GroupIconify)
     If this is `on', (un)iconifying any DDD window causes all other
     DDD windows to (un)iconify as well.  Default is `off', meaning
     that each DDD window can be iconified on its own.

   If you want to keep DDD off your desktop during a longer
computation, you may like to set `Edit => Preferences => General =>
Uniconify when ready'.  This way, you can iconify DDD while it is busy
on a command (e.g. running a program); DDD will automatically pop up
again after becoming ready (e.g. after the debugged program has stopped
at a breakpoint).  Note: Program Stop, for a discussion.

   Here is the related resource:

 -- Resource: uniconifyWhenReady (class UniconifyWhenReady)
     If this is `on' (default), the DDD windows are uniconified
     automatically whenever GDB becomes ready.  This way, you can
     iconify DDD during some longer operation and have it uniconify
     itself as soon as the program stops.  Setting this to `off' leaves
     the DDD windows iconified.
